LOUISVILLE, Ky. (WDRB) -- A woman died after being shot near a Louisville restaurant March 23, according to Louisville Metro Police.

Last Sunday, LMPD officers responded to a shooting in the 5500 block of New Cut Road. When police arrived at the scene, they found a woman who had been shot outside of the business.

She was taken to UofL Hospital in critical condition, but LMPD confirmed Wednesday that she died there. The victim was identified Wednesday as 23-year-old Jayde Isaac.

LMPD's Homicide Unit is handling the investigation. Police don't know if the victim was an employee or patron of the restaurant, and are working to learn what led up to the shooting and a motive. 

Police said all parties are accounted for and LMPD's Homicide Unit will work with the Commonwealth Attorney's Office to determine if any charges are warranted.
